    The New York League of Conservation Voters (NYLCV) is the only statewide environmental organization in New York that fights for clean water, clean air, renewable energy, and open space through advocacy and politics. We’re nonpartisan, pragmatic, and effective with a proven track record of success. Along with our sister organizations, the NYLCV Education Fund, NYLCV Victory Fund, and NYLCV Gives Green, we educate the public about a broad range of important issues and elect candidates that will champion our priorities of climate action and environmental protections.

    Position Summary

    The Development & Events Coordinator will provide key support to the Development Department in achieving its annual fundraising plan. This person will report to the Senior Director of Development and will work closely with the Development Coordinator, Chief of Staff and President.

    Essential Functions & Responsibilities

    Events

    • Manage the organization’s fundraising events across the state, including the annual Gala
    • Track sponsor lists, pledges and contributions as well as strategizing pathways to achieve event fundraising goals
    • Coordinate with event speakers and guests
    • Coordinate with event venues and external vendors on menu, AV needs and additional logistics
    • Draft and manage invitations and event promotional materials, including sponsor listings and benefits
    • Manage the day-of event logistics and operations including delegating tasks
    • Supporting the Development Coordinator at monthly Corporate Partners breakfasts

    Donor Communications

    • Coordinate an annual appeal and stewardship calendar
    • Work with the Development Coordinator and Communications Team to ensure donor acknowledgement plan is implemented effectively and efficiently
    • Develop donor cultivation strategies for donor prospects and draft donor correspondence
    • Support the team’s fundraising appeals and digital fundraising campaigns, including drafting emails and letters, and working with the Communications Department to brainstorm and execute creative ways of engaging our donors
    • Work with the programs, policy and politics departments to coordinate briefings and donor stewardship activities
    • Help identify donor prospects through research and creating donor profiles as needed
    • Occasionally attend donor meetings with senior staff including the President
    • Help keep the development team on track by taking notes in meetings and managing up when necessary

    Emerging Leaders Program

    • Coordinate NYLCV’s young professionals program, Emerging Leaders, including recruiting new members and engaging the steering committee
    • Maintain up to date records on the program, create promotional material and develop a plan for the program’s growth and sustainability
    • Coordinate at least two fundraising events annually

    Administration

    • Work with the Development Coordinator on the yearly audit
    • Maintain organized and updated records and documents in the shared drive
    • Support the Development Coordinator with twice yearly board engagement reports
    • Review and provide feedback on weekly revenue report
    • Other administrative tasks as needed
